First off, I can't say enough good things about the Untamed, fantastic on house shots.  Mine's drilled with the pin beside the ring finger (the medium revving continuation drilling).  Typically playing a 15 out to 7 type of line with great success.  My question is would the grease monkey with a similar drilling be a good step down ball or would it be too similar?  I've got a pin down Torrid Elite that is great for playing outside when I can but I can't stay inside with it and have it make the corner hard enough.  Thoughts?

Without knowing your complete set of specs and the type of lanes and oil you see regularly, I can only guess at a ball choice. It seems to me that you have 3 obvious choices in the Radical line. Each will have their own strengths as well as shortcomings...your pro shop guy should be able to help you with the choice.

IMO you are looking at either the original Yeti, the Torrid Affair or the Grease Monkey. Personally I would lean toward the Torrid Affair because the ball is so incredibly versatile but who could argue with the other 2 options? Lol
